Cultural Context

Marinated Carne Asada is a beloved dish in Mexican cuisine, often enjoyed during family gatherings and celebrations. The term 'carne asada' translates to 'grilled meat,' typically made with beef marinated in a flavorful mixture of citrus juices and spices. This dish embodies the spirit of outdoor grilling, bringing people together over delicious food. Today, it is popular not only in Mexico but also in the United States, where it has become a staple at barbecues and taco stands.

1

Trim any silver skin off the flank steak if necessary.

2

Combine orange juice, tequila, olive oil, white vinegar, garlic, salt, black pepper, and cumin in a gallon ziplock bag.

3

Add the flank steak to the ziplock bag and seal it, ensuring the steak is well-coated with the marinade.

4

Marinate the steak for 4 to 6 hours in the refrigerator.

5

Preheat the Pit Boss pellet grill to 450°F.

6

Remove the steak from the marinade and discard the marinade.

7

Wipe off excess marinade from the steak to prevent burning.

8

Drizzle olive oil on the steak to prevent sticking on the grill.

9

Place the flank steak on the grill over direct flame.

10

Grill for about 2.5 to 3 minutes on one side, then flip it at a 45-degree angle.

11

Grill for another 2.5 minutes, then flip it again to char the other side for about 2 minutes.

12

Remove the steak from the grill and let it rest for about 10 minutes before slicing.

13

Slice the steak against the grain into thin strips and garnish with cilantro.
